    UNIVERSITY OF KERALA
    SEMESTER-III CORE COURSE –I
    Methodology of Plant Science
    (Model question paper)
    Course Code : BO 1341
    Time : 3 hrs Total Weightage : 30

    SECTION – A
    Answer the following
    Draw diagrams wherever necessary
    (Questions in bunches of four; Each bunch carries a weightage of 1)
    I. Choose the correct answer
    1. The amount of light absorbed by a material is proportional to the concentration of the absorbing solution is referred as
    a) Beer's law
    b) Boger-lambert law
    c) Poiseuille's law
    d) all of the above

    2. The first patented life form belongs to the kingdom
    a) Plantae
    b) Monera
    c) Protista
    d) Animalia

    3. The ratio of diameter of lenses to its focal length is referred as
    a) Magnification
    b) Resolution
    c) Numerical aperture
    d) none of the above

    4. pH of pure water is
    a) 7.8
    b) 6.5
    c) 7.0
    d) none of the above

    II. Answer in one word or in a sentence
    5. Expand PAGE
    6. Mention the function of Iris Diaphragm in a light microscope
    7. Which acts as a stationery phase in paper chromatography?
    8. The finding that there was little or no water within the DNA molecule led Watson to build the correct structure of DNA. Who correctly spotted the mistake concerned with water content?

    III. State true or false
    9. An observational investigation does not generally start out with a hypothesis
    10. The concept of partition coefficient is the basic principle of all chromatographic methods.
    11. DPX is a killing and fixing fluid.
    12. PAGE stands for Polyadenylamide gel electrophoresis

    IV. Fill in the blanks
    13. The technique of isoelectric focussing was discovered by……………..
    14. The most widely used apparatus for the determination of radioactive isotopes is…….
    15. The unit of sedimentation coefficient is known as ………….
    16. For studying the external morphology of pollen grains, ………..technique is commonly used.

    SECTION-B
    Answer any Eight
    (Short answer questions; each question carries a weightage of 1)
    17. What is double staining?
    18. Stage micrometer and ocular micrometer.
    19. Explain Carnoy’s formula
    20. Describe magnification and resolution of a light microscope.
